Poster art in Britain during the 1920's and 30's was a thriving industry enabled by enlightened clients such as Shell-Mex, The London Underground and the four railway companies. Dr Graham Twemlow's talk will cover the work of poster artists such as Paul Nash, E McKnight Kauffer, Frank Newbould and Tom Purvis.
